An Act concerning grants from federal COVID-19 relief programs.

 

     Be It Enacted by the Senate and General Assembly of the State of New Jersey:

 

     1.    a.  To the extent consistent with federal law and regulations of the federal agencies involved, all federal funding for co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) relief, aid, or stimulus provided to the State to disburse to local governments in the form of a grant program, and not already dispersed, committed, or incurred as of the effective date of P.L.     , c.    (C.         ) (pending before the Legislature as this bill), shall be disbursed proportionally according to population with no minimum population required to receive federal funding.

     b.    Prior to enactment of this section, the Department of the Treasury, in consultation with the Department of Community Affairs, the Department of Health, and the New Jersey Economic Development Authority, shall promulgate regulations pursuant to the "Administrative Procedure Act," P.L.1968, c.410 (C.52:14B-1 et seq.), defining the new criteria for the grant programs, based on need, for local governments to apply.  The Department of the Treasury shall post the regulations on the department's Internet website.

 

     2.    This act shall take effect 90 days after enactment and shall expire upon the disbursement of all federal COVID-19 grant monies for local governments.

 

 

STATEMENT

 

     To the extent consistent with federal law and regulations of the federal agencies involved, all federal funding for COVID-19 relief, aid, or stimulus provided to the State to disburse to local governments in the form of a grant program, and not already dispersed, committed, or incurred as of the effective date of the bill, would be disbursed proportionally according to population with no minimum population required to receive federal funding.

     Prior to enactment of the bill, the Department of the Treasury, in consultation with the Department of Community Affairs, the Department of Health, and the New Jersey Economic Development Authority, would be required to promulgate regulations, and post the regulations on its Internet website, defining the new criteria for the grant programs, based on need, for local governments to apply.

     The bill would take effect 90 days after enactment and shall expire upon the disbursement of all federal COVID-19 grant monies for local governments.
